Linux权限管理详解:如何理解和设置Linux的权限系统

时间:2025-12-06 分类:操作系统

Linux操作系统以其强大的功能和灵活性广受欢迎。在Linux中,权限管理是确保系统安全和保护数据的重要机制。通过合理配置权限,用户可以控制谁能访问文件、目录,以及谁可以执行相应的操作。理解Linux的权限系统不仅对系统管理员至关重要,也帮助普通用户在日常使用中避免潜在的安全隐患。Linux的权限管理体系相对复杂,但一旦掌握其要点,便能有效提升系统的安全性与稳定性。

Linux权限管理详解:如何理解和设置Linux的权限系统

在Linux系统中,文件和目录的权限主要分为三种:读、写和执行。这些权限针对三类用户进行设置:文件的所有者、所属组和其他用户(即其他所有人)。通过这种细分,Linux实现了灵活的权限控制。权限可以通过命令行工具进行查看和修改。例如,使用`ls -l`命令可以列出文件的详细信息,包括它的权限。而更改权限则通常使用`chmod`命令,结合不同的参数设置相应的权限。

在深入理解权限的Linux提供了几种不同的权限模式。最常见的是绝对模式和相对模式。绝对模式使用数字(如777、755等)来表示权限,而相对模式则通过符号(如+、-、=)来调整权限。这两种模式各有优势,熟练运用将提高权限管理的效率。

除了基本的权限设置,Linux还支持更高级的权限管理功能,如粘滞位(Sticky Bit)和SUID/SGID权限。粘滞位主要用于目录,确保只有文件的所有者可以删除或重命名目录中的文件。SUID和SGID则允许用户以文件所有者的权限执行程序,这在特定情况下非常有用,但也需谨慎设置,以防带来安全风险。

在设置Linux权限时,最佳实践是遵循最小权限原则。这意味着用户和程序仅应被授予完成其工作所需的最低权限。这样的做法不仅有助于提高系统安全性,还能显著减少潜在的安全漏洞。定期检查权限设置,及时清理不必要的访问权限也是维护系统安全的重要手段。

Linux的权限管理是一个复杂但极其重要的主题。通过理解和灵活运用这些权限设置,用户可以有效保护自己的文件和目录,维护系统的安全性。不同的权限设置应根据实际需求进行个性化调整,以更好地适应日常使用场景。掌握Linux权限管理,不仅能提升个人用户的安全意识,更能帮助团队构建一个安全可靠的操作环境。